Responsibilities:
- Plan and lead the technical delivery of programmes of work, such as hydrodynamic simulations/experiments of ships and submarines in support of design and operation.
- Breakdown complex tasks and then execute the planned schedule of work.
- Work with project managers to track progress, assign tasks and supervise the technical delivery team.
- Participate in business development activities.
